IBS, piles, diverticular disease, polyps, food intolerances (yes they can pop up in adulthood) or GI cancer (although this is NOT the most likely outcome so please don't panic.) fibroids, cervical erosion, prolapse, rectocele... could be anyone of a number of things.

You need some bloods, a full GI workup and a full gynae workup.

Do not bugger about with ‘cleanses.’ That’s just hokum. There’s absolutely zero evidence that cleanses do anything at all.
